Top alternatives

3 Results

Top best Games like IMVU

Top alternative Games like IMVU 2D games we­re commonly played in the past, but 3D te­chnology has transformed the gaming expe­rience. IMVU, a well-known avatar-base­d game, is particularly enjoyable if […]